How Charlotte's Climate Forms Heating system Wear

The Carolinas being in an area where winter months swings between completely dry cool spikes and damp, freezing stretches. That mix is hard on a heater. If you remain in an older home in Plaza Midwood or Dilworth, you may have a mid-efficiency gas heating system coupled with initial ductwork that was never secured. In newer builds south of I‑485, you'll regularly discover high-efficiency condensing heaters coupled with tighter envelopes. Each arrangement stops working differently.

Intermittent use invites a couple of troubles. Condensate lines on high-efficiency heating systems can establish algae and freeze during abrupt temperature drops, which journeys security switches and shuts out the furnace. Lengthy idle stretches allow dirt to cake on fire sensing units and ignitors, requiring duplicated cycling and brief pauses that resemble thermostat problems to the inexperienced eye. In electrical heaters, specifically those utilized as emergency situation warm for heatpump systems, sequencers and aspects struggle with start-stop patterns that disclose themselves exactly when you need steady output.

Humidity is the various other personality in this tale. Dampness is gentle on hardwood floors but hard on electronics and steel surfaces. Control panel and terminals rust a little faster here than in drier climates. That alone is a reason to arrange preventative heating system maintenance in Charlotte before the period begins.

What "Top-Rated" Actually Looks Like

It's tempting to judge a company by the gloss of its trucks or the variety of lawn signs in your community. Those are marketing informs, not solution quality. When you book furnace repair in Charlotte with a service provider who continually makes luxury evaluations, you see three differences that matter.

First, they listen carefully to your description prior to touching a device. If your heater shuts out overnight however behaves during the day, if you scent a pale metallic smell, if the unit short-cycles just when both downstairs and upstairs areas ask for heat, these ideas assist a targeted analysis. A rushed technology who jumps right to "you require a brand-new board" generally misses out on the origin cause.

Second, they show you numbers. Fixed stress readings, temperature surge throughout the warmth exchanger, micro-amp readings on fire sensing units, capacitor microfarads contrasted to rating, CO dimensions for combustion evaluation. A pro does not claim "it's borderline," they discuss "your temperature level rise is 75 degrees against a nameplate score of 45 to 65, which indicates low airflow or an overfired problem." Transparency turns a secret into a workable decision.

Third, they supply alternatives. Change just the stopped working flame sensor, or tidy the sensor and estimate a brand-new ignitor likely to fail within the season, or suggest a much deeper air flow and air duct evaluation if metrics suggest a systemic constraint. That food selection values your spending plan without punting on the lasting fix.

The Upkeep Routine That Stops Most Winter Months Breakdowns

A Charlotte heater doesn't need a dozen service calls a year, but it does need one detailed check out in very early loss. Consider it as your seasonal tune-up and safety check rolled together. A mindful specialist carries out a series that looks straightforward on paper but avoids the usual issues:

  • Filter and airflow: Inspect filter size and fit, not just tidiness. I see numerous 1-inch filters obstructed in a return that was sized for a much thicker media cabinet. That mismatch cuts airflow and presses temperature increase out of specification. For many homes, the upgrade to a 4- or 5-inch media filter lowers pressure decrease and catches dust much better, which keeps warm exchangers tidy and blowers efficient.
  • Combustion and airing vent: On gas heating systems, validate manifold gas stress, check fire features, and measure CO in the flue. High-efficiency systems need their PVC airing vent incline checked to prevent condensate merging. In a couple of communities with lengthy horizontal runs to exterior wall surfaces, a straightforward adjustment in incline clears persisting lockouts.
  • Electrical health and wellness: Examination ignitor resistance, verify inducer and blower amperage against the nameplate, and check for blistered or loosened cables at the control panel. On electrical heating systems, confirm heat strip operation in stages and inspect sequencer timing so you do not pound your electric service with an instant 15 to 20 kW draw.
  • Condensate monitoring: Prime and flush the catch, clear the line, and validate the safety and security float switch functions. A $10 float switch has saved more service require me than any kind of other part.
  • Controls and interaction: Adjust or replace exhausted thermostats, confirm thermostat programs for heat pump systems, and make certain complementary warmth staging is set properly. If your thermostat obscures the line between heatpump and heating system feature, back-up warm may run longer than needed and increase your energy bill.

Common Failings I See Every Winter

I maintain a psychological tally of regular culprits. In gas heating systems, filthy fire sensing units top the checklist. They create a weak micro-amp signal and the board believes the flame has actually headed out, so it shuts gas to stay clear of a threat. Cleansing usually restores solution, however a sensor that has actually been fined sand to fatality requires substitute. Next come hot surface area ignitors, which can split from taking care of or thermal shock. A technology ought to never touch the ignitor surface area with bare fingers; skin oils develop hot spots that reduce life.

Pressure buttons and obstructed inducer ports are one more motif. Charlotte's plant pollen and fine dirt move anywhere the inducer can aspirate it. An easy cleansing and a brand-new silicone tube can return the switch to spec, but beware if the underlying cause is a partly obstructed second heat exchanger on a condensing heater. In those situations, the repair service extends beyond the switch.

On electrical heating systems, loose high-voltage links bake themselves in time. I have actually tightened up terminals in attics where summertime warm and wintertime vibration conspired to loosen lugs. If you scent a pale plastic odor and see warmth discoloration near components, eliminate power and call a pro. Changing a scorched incurable block now defeats changing an entire aspect financial institution later.

Finally, control panel fail, but much less commonly than individuals believe. If you listen to a tech blame the board within five minutes, ask to see the analysis path. A board is the mind, however like any kind of brain, it acts on the signals it receives. When stress switches, limitation switches, and sensing units feed nonsense, the board makes a secure choice and shuts out. Deal with the rubbish first.

Repair Versus Substitute: A Decision That Should Be Monotonous, Not Dramatic

I rarely chat a home owner right into replacement on the initial see because the math ought to be dispassionate. Think about age, security, reliability, and running expense. Gas heaters generally last 15 to 20 years here, often more with good care. Electric heating systems can run even much longer considering that they have fewer relocating components, though they cost more to operate.

If your warmth exchanger is split, there's no dispute. CO threat finishes the conversation, and we relocate to replacement. If a mid-life furnace has a string of moderate failures, I tally the last 2 years of billings and approximate the following 2. If you're investing greater than a quarter of a substitute expense on repairs without any clear end to the pattern, you're paying tuition to keep an unstable device. For performance upgrades, I urge sensible expectations. A jump from 80 percent to 95 percent AFUE sounds significant, but your gas use for heating is a portion of your annual energy spend. In Charlotte, the comfort enhancements usually offer the upgrade greater than the energy savings. Quieter blowers, far better humidity control, cleaner filtering, zoning that ultimately balances upstairs and downstairs temperatures, those daily success typically warrant the investment.

If you do replace, insist that the discussion consists of ductwork. Dissimilar air ducts are why brand-new high-efficiency furnaces short-cycle and why operating noise lets down. I have actually gauged static stress in brand-new homes that were double the tools's maximum ranking. A tiny financial investment in extra return air or properly sized supply runs does extra for convenience than bumping up tools tonnage. Larger is not much better in home heating devices; right-sized is.

Smart Thermostats, Heat Pumps, and Hybrid Systems

Charlotte hinges on a pleasant area for crossbreed warm systems that couple a heatpump with a gas heater or electrical air handler. On milder days, the heatpump offers effective warm. When temperatures glide right into the 30s and below, the heater takes over for stronger, drier heat. Frequently, these systems are misconfigured. I see lockout temperature levels for heatpump set too reduced, causing the heatpump to run inefficiently in problems it does not such as. Or the supporting warm is allowed to run all at once with the heatpump when it should not, increasing bills.

A wise thermostat just pays off if it's set up correctly. Make sure the installer identifies the system type, stages, and equilibrium factor. If your thermostat keeps overshooting setpoints, look at the cycle price settings. Shorter cycles can reduce the "yo‑yo" result in limited homes, while longer cycles might match draftier older houses.

Wi Fi thermostats likewise help you notice patterns. If the system runs continuously yet never reaches the setpoint on cool evenings, you may have a capacity or air duct issue, not a thermostat concern. Use data to ask much better inquiries throughout your following heater service in Charlotte.

Safety, Always

A gas furnace is a secure appliance furnace filter replacement MERV 11 when maintained, and a high-risk one when neglected. Every home heating period I find at the very least a few heating systems airing vent imperfectly right into attic rooms or crawlspaces. The passengers may only see frustrations or heavy air. If your carbon monoxide detectors are more than seven years old, change them. If you do not have a low-level carbon monoxide monitor, consider one. The generally marketed plug-in alarms are made to avoid acute poisoning, not sharp at lower degrees that can show a developing problem.

I likewise recommend a straightforward smell examination every time your heater kicks on after a lengthy idle. The scent of dust burning off the warmth exchanger for a couple of mins is regular. A sharp metal or electric smell, a pop or sizzle, or visible charring near wiring is not. Cut power at the switch or breaker and ask for solution. For electrical furnaces, the safety lens has to do with clean clearances and limited links. For gas systems, it's combustion honesty and air flow. Either way, a cautious seasonal check maintains families safe.

What You Can Do Between Expert Visits

Not every job demands a vehicle and a toolbag. Homeowners can stop half the nuisance calls I see with a couple of behaviors. I suggest 2 basic regimens that repay right away:

  • Check and change filters regularly, however additionally match filter type to your system. If you make use of 1-inch pleated filters because they're practical, exchange them more regularly, occasionally regular monthly during high-use durations. If you have family pets or run the fan typically for air cleaning, tip up to a thicker media filter real estate to maintain airflow.
  • Keep the condensate line clear. If your heater drains to a pump, put a mug of white vinegar into the drainpipe line every number of months to discourage algae. Ensure the pump discharge tube is safe and secure and terminates properly. Listen for the pump cycle. It needs to run quickly, after that stop. If it chatters, it's either stopping working or managing a partial blockage.

Beyond these, view your thermostat readouts. If the system cycled 3 times in an hour yet your interior temperature hardly budged, that suggests restricted airflow or a mis-sized system. If the heater impacts cozy, after that trendy, then warm again during a single ask for heat, inform your service technician. These details save analysis time and labor charges.

Edge Situations and Real Repairs I have actually Seen

A Myers Park home owner whined that her brand-new 96 percent heater locked out just on moist early mornings. The installer had actually included a long horizontal air vent kept up insufficient incline. Condensate pooled overnight, obstructing the inducer flow at startup. A re-pitch of the PVC, plus a cleanout tee, ended the legend. No new board required.

In a South End townhome, the heater short-cycled every single time the downstairs and upstairs zones called at once. The perpetrator wasn't the furnace; it was the zoning panel logic coupled with under-sized returns. The heater exceeded its temperature level rise limitation and struck the high-limit button. We increased return capacity and adjusted fan rate setups. The same heating furnace cleaning and safety check system currently runs quietly and steadily.

A College location leasing kept stressing out sequencers in an electric furnace. The property manager swapped components continuously. The source was a missing panel screw that left a space, so cool attic air washed over the sequencer during each telephone call. That continuous thermal shock eliminated the part too soon. One screw dealt with a lucrative however unneeded pattern of repairs.

When to Call Prior to Points Get Urgent

If you're new to the area or brand-new to homeownership, schedule your initial maintenance in late September. You'll beat the rush and have time to deal with air movement tweaks or components that need buying. If your heater mores than 12 years of ages, an annual check comes to be more important. The failing contour steepens a little every year. If your system is still under supplier warranty, yearly service is commonly needed to maintain that protection intact.

Call swiftly if you see repeated heating system lockouts, unusual scents, visible residue, or water near the heater. Electric costs or gas expenses that jump without a matching temperature level decrease also are worthy of a look. And if any individual in the home feels headaches or nausea or vomiting when the warm runs, quit reviewing, shut the system off, and obtain a safety and security check with carbon monoxide screening right away.
